Output 4de8db879d185244861521341cd521710b6cc334ddb03188d7557c0a49581087:1

value
584371018
script pubkey
OP_0 OP_PUSHBYTES_20 369f714f658dc2699e8d630d803e7c2585a26805
address
bc1qx60hznm93hpxn85dvvxcq0nuykz6y6q9y7zcav
transaction
4de8db879d185244861521341cd521710b6cc334ddb03188d7557c0a49581087
confirmations
104444
spent
true